US ambassador to the UN says China would
cross 'red line' by providing lethal aid
to Russia

Original Article

Posted By: Dreadnought, 2/19/2023 9:21:15 PM

The US ambassador to the United Nations said Sunday that China would cross a "red line" if the country decided to provide lethal military aid to Russia for its invasion of Ukraine. "We welcome the Chinese announcement that they want peace because that's what we always want to pursue in situations like this. But we also have to be clear that if there are any thoughts and efforts by the Chinese and others to provide lethal support to the Russians in their brutal attack against Ukraine, that that is unacceptable," Ambassador Linda Thomas-Greenfield told CNN's Pamela Brown on "State of the Union." "That would be a red line," she said.

U.S. Secretary of Transportation Pete Buttigieg has called out the rail operator at the center of a hazardous train derailment in Ohio. In a sharply worded, three-page letter sent Sunday to Norfolk Southern Railway president and CEO Alan Shaw, Buttigieg accused the Atlanta-based company of repeatedly prioritizing profit over safety -- a problematic ethos within the larger transportation industry that the secretary said has contributed to a number of derailments over the years. Blinken announces $100M more in earthquake
aid during visit to Turkey
19 replies
Posted by Imright 2/20/2023 12:57:02 AM Post Reply
U.S. Secretary of State Antony Blinken on Sunday traveled to survey damage from two devastating earthquakes as he announced $100 million in funds for Turkey and Syria. "Profoundly saddened to see firsthand the devastation of the earthquakes in Turkey. The United States remains committed to doing everything we can to help with rescue, relief and recovery efforts," Blinken said in a statement. Blinken said the United States has already responded with $85 million in humanitarian assistance after a 7.8-magnitude earthquake struck Turkey and Syria on Feb. 6 followed by a 7.7-magnitude earthquake hours later, leaving tens of thousands dead.
